Flavones (from Latin flavus "yellow") are a class of flavonoids based on the backbone of 2-phenylchromen-4-one (2-phenyl-1-benzopyran-4-one) (as shown in the first image of this article). Flavones are common in foods, mainly from spices, and some yellow or orange fruits and vegetables. Common flavones include … Ver mais The estimated daily intake of flavones is about 2 mg per day. Ver mais WebFlavonoids are composed of two aromatic ring systems (A, B rings), which are formed by different biosynthetic pathways. The B ring is derived from the shikimate pathway via phenylalanine. The general phenylpropanoid pathway starts with the deamination of phenylalanine to trans -cinnamic acid.
